Eğitimin polis memurlarinin iş tatminlerine etkisi: Türk Polis Teşkilatı örneği

The effects of education on police officer job satisfaction: The case of Turkish National Police

Abstract (2. Language): 
There has been an assumed relationship between police officer job satisfaction and education for many decades. There is small number of quantitative research to demonstrate the relationship between education and police officer job satisfaction. This study examines to what extent education is related to job satisfaction facets, including police officers’ satisfaction with colleagues, supervisors, promotions and work. The population of this study consisted of police officers of all ranks from various departments of the Turkish National Police (TNP). This study specifically addresses the question of intrinsic job satisfaction and education for police officers. These findings should add to management literature on job satisfaction and provide some of the first findings of this type for a police population, because there are already some studies in general on the relationship between education and job satisfaction which are mentioned in the literature review. This study also contributes to the body of literature that exists on police officer satisfaction and education.
Abstract (Original Language): 
Son yıllarda polislerin iş tatminleri ile eğitim durumları arasında bir ilişkinin olduğu kabul edilmektedir, fakat bu ilişkiyi ortaya koyar mahiyette sayısal verilere dayalı çok fazla çalışma bulunmamaktadır. Bu çalışmada polis memurlarının eğitim durumlarının iş tatminlerine olan etkisi dört farklı kategoride ele alınarak değerlendirilmektedir. Bunlar; polis memurlarının çalışma arkadaşlarına, yöneticilerine, iş ortamlarına ve meslekte yükselmelerine yönelik olarak iş tatminleridir. Çalışma Türk Polis Teşkilatının çeşitli birimlerinde görev yapan ve her rütbedeki çalışanları içermektedir. Bu çalışma polis memurlarının eğitim durumları ile iş tatminlerini esas almaktadır. Çalışma sonucunda elde edilen bulgular iş tatmini konusunda literatüre katkı sağlayabilir. Literatürde belirtildiği üzere, genel manada eğitim ve iş tatmini arasındaki ilişkiyi konu alan çalışmalar mevcut olmasına rağmen bu yoğunluktaki bir polis organizasyonu için ilk çalışma özelliği taşımaktadır. Ayrıca polis memurlarının iş tatmini ve eğitimleri arasındaki ilişki noktasındaki literatüre katkı sağlayacak bir çalışma niteliğinde olacaktır
